Bathroom Conversion Service in Framingham, MA
Bathroom conversion services involve transforming existing bathroom spaces into new layouts or functionalities to better meet the needs of homeowners. This can include converting a bathtub into a walk-in shower, transforming a small half-bath into a full bathroom, or repurposing underused areas like closets or storage rooms into functional bathrooms. Such projects often aim to improve accessibility, maximize space, or update the style and fixtures to match current preferences. Property owners typically seek guidance on the scope of the conversion, the structural changes involved, and how the renovation may impact plumbing and electrical systems.
Before requesting bathroom conversion services, homeowners should consider the current layout and what changes they desire. It’s helpful to understand the potential limitations of the existing plumbing and electrical infrastructure, as these can influence the feasibility of certain conversions. Clarifying the intended use, desired fixtures, and any accessibility features can also ensure the project aligns with expectations. Property owners often want to know about the necessary permits, the overall scope of work, and how the conversion might affect the property's value and functionality.

Bathroom Conversion Service Questions
What is a bathroom conversion service? Bathroom conversion involves transforming an existing space into a different type of bathroom, such as turning a tub area into a shower or adding a separate toilet room.
What types of conversions are commonly requested? Common conversions include replacing bathtubs with walk-in showers, adding accessible features, or creating additional bathroom spaces within existing layouts.
What should homeowners consider before a bathroom conversion? It’s important to assess the current plumbing layout, available space, and any local building codes that may affect the project.
How does a bathroom conversion impact property value? Converting and updating bathrooms can enhance functionality and appeal, potentially increasing the property's value and attractiveness to future buyers.
